Job Summary

As a Customer Service/Sales Representative, you'll be responsible for providing exceptional customer service, learning about our products and services, and driving sales growth in your assigned department. You'll work closely with your Department Supervisor and other associates to ensure a safe and shop-able environment for customers. With a focus on building relationships and delivering results, you'll be an integral part of our team, helping to drive business growth and customer satisfaction.

Key Responsibilities

* Provide fast, friendly service to customers, assessing their needs and providing assistance with products and services

  • Learn about products and services using our tools and training programs, and provide information to customers to drive sales growth
  • Greet, qualify, recommend, and close every customer in your department, and know how to handle basics in adjacent departments
  • Maintain the in-stock condition of assigned areas, ensuring they are clean, shop-able, and safe
  • Provide a safe working and shopping environment by following all safety policies and standards, completing specified safety training, and reporting hazards or unsafe conditions to the Manager on Duty
  • Work in cooperation with your Department Supervisor and other associates in your department, as well as other departments
  • Participate in sales and customer service initiatives to drive business growth and customer satisfaction

Essential Qualifications

* High school diploma or equivalent required; associate's or bachelor's degree in a related field preferred

  • 1-2 years of customer service or sales experience, preferably in a retail or home improvement environment
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build relationships with customers and colleagues
  • Strong product knowledge and sales skills, with the ability to learn and adapt to new products and services
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ment, with a focus on delivering exceptional customer service and driving sales growth
  • Basic math skills and accuracy with handling cash and operating a point-of-sale system
